Mac 安裝MySQL有兩種方式mysql
- 下載地址:https://www.mysql.com/downloads/
- 滾動網頁至最下方,選擇`DOWNLOADS => MySQL Community Server`
複製代碼
不配置環境變量的話,執行mysql命令,必須在mysql的安裝目錄下,因此選擇配置環境變量。在終端中,進入到用戶目錄下,執行 `vim .bash_profile` 或者直接執行`vim ~/.bash_profile` ,按`i`進入編輯模式,添加以下內容,按`esc`,輸入`:wq`退出並保存。
```
# mysql
export PATH=${PATH}:/usr/local/mysql/bin
#快速啓動、結束MySQL服務, 能夠使用alias命令
alias mysqlstart='sudo /usr/local/mysql/support-files/mysql.server start'
alias mysqlstop='sudo /usr/local/mysql/support-files/mysql.server stop'
```
咱們就能夠在任何地方執行mysql命令了。
- 終端輸入`myqsl -u root -p`啓動MySQL,安裝地址是`/usr/local/mysql`
複製代碼
安裝命令sql
```
brew install mysql
```
複製代碼
mysql_secure_installation
執行後報錯:
mysql_secure_installation: [ERROR] unknown variable 'default-character-set=utf8'.,不妨礙繼續設置密碼
mysql.server start
重啓一下,而後
mysql_secure_installation
若是不想設置過於複雜的密碼,能夠先用空密碼(直接回車)啓動服務vim
SHOW VARIABLES LIKE 'validate_password%';
進行查看validate_password.policy
的全局參數爲 LOW 便可,輸入設值語句
SET GLOBAL validate_password.policy=LOW;
進行設值
validate_password_length
的全局參數爲6便可,輸入設值語句
SET GLOBAL validate_password.length=6;
進行設值
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'123456';
能夠看到修改爲功,表示密碼策略修改爲功了!!!(此時不能使用mysql_secure_installation
去設置密碼啦!)注意:修改爲功後,最好重啓下mysql.server start
bash